English

Etymology

    Borrowed from Cebuano trainor, itself from English trainer.

    Noun

    trainor (plural trainors)

    1. (Philippines) A person who trains another; a coach, a trainer.

    Cebuano

    Etymology

      From a misspelling of English trainer.

      Noun

      trainor

      1. a person who trains another; a coach, a trainer

      Descendants

      • English: trainor
